Question
In a heterozygous parent (Tt), what percentage of gametes will carry the T allele and what percentage will carry the t allele?
Options
100% T and 0% t
66% T and 34% t
50% T and 50% t
75% T and 25% t

Solution
During meiosis in a heterozygous parent (Tt), the alleles segregate equally during Meiosis I. The homologous chromosomes carrying T and t are pulled to opposite poles, resulting in two types of gametes produced in equal proportions: 50% carrying the T allele and 50% carrying the t allele. This 1:1 ratio ensures random assortment of alleles to the next generation.
